officer of the guard in American English
an officer in immediate command of the interior guard of a garrison
noun: an officer, acting under the officer of the day, who is responsible for the instruction, discipline, and performance of duty of the guard in a post, camp, or station

officer of the guard in British English
noun: a junior officer whose duty is to command a ceremonial guard
